Transaction 2945812a3df028ddc016bb0e20ff14f091595ede3b03def36714aeba546df6b9
1 Input
1 Output
-
2945812a3df028ddc016bb0e20ff14f091595ede3b03def36714aeba546df6b9:0
- value
- 703368
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e445ecc2db613eecab100fc385cfa0f6e9deabb6 OP_EQUAL
- address
- 3NW1kk9VyyBNs7B5YdPEkm2E8NFarNeaZx